Abstract

The Kariba dam spans the border between Zimbabwe and Zambia and has two power stations in the north and south, providing more than 50 percent of electricity to Zambia and Zimbabwe and benefiting about 4.5 million people. But now the Kariba Dam was damaged seriously. Once it collapses, it will directly threaten the lives of more than 3.5 million inhabitants of Zambia, Zimbabwe, Mozambique and Malawi, as well as the supply of electricity throughout the region.
